Transforming the Future with Convergence of Simulation and Data

Quality / Reliability Engineer Powertrain

Job Summary

Our client in Windsor, ON is looking for a Quality / Reliability Engineer Powertrain. This is a contract position.

What You Will Do

  • Implement commodity-specific business plans to ensure your suppliers exceed all corporate launch, quality, capacity, warranty metrics, and vehicle delivery.
  • Lead cross-functional decisions with Our Client & Supplier leadership to drive resolution of open issues.
  • Implement actions to ensure zero vehicle losses from suppliers.
  • Principal for on-site troubleshooting and corrective actions for emergency supplier situations.
  • Lead adherence to Our Client's standards (i.e.Q1).
  • Lead Critical Supplier Process to drive Supplier Quality Reject (QR) performance improvement.
  • Participate in Whiteboard reviews and assigned sub-system VRT (Variability Reduction Team) meetings. Drive resolution of external supplier process -1MIS and 0MIS warranty concerns.
  • Support QR procedures by supporting concern binning, reviewing threshold QRs, and providing support for QR Dispute resolution. Assist the Incoming Quality (IQ) department with non-responsive suppliers. Assist suppliers and plants in QR / PPM (Parts Per Million) data accuracy.
  • Drive assessment & validation of manufacturing feasibility at identified supplier sites.
  • Execute the Production Part Approval Process (PPAP) and Advanced Quality Planning Process (APQP).
  • Use available data, metrics, and business plans to drive future sourcing decisions ensuring improved future quality.
  • Implement commodity-specific business plans to ensure your suppliers exceed all corporate launch, quality, capacity, warranty metrics, and vehicle delivery.
  • Lead on-site troubleshooting and corrective actions for emergency supplier situations.
  • Coordinate part quality confirmation process for suppliers with repetitive containment failure.
  • Lead containment of special‑cause supplier process -1MIS and 0MIS BSAQ (Balanced Single Agenda for Quality) projects.
  • Align with VRT on Supplier Process (SP) BSAQ issues for Glidepath values.
  • Provide early notification to and engage the STA Site team on potential Stop Shipments related to supplier process (SP).
  • Provide support in containing supplier Stop Ship issues. Assist Site STA team with vehicle On‑Hold and Release process tracking.
  • Work with Stop Ship stakeholders to support accurate root cause for Prevent Action Closure (PAC) process reporting.
  • Monitor daily production report (DPR) and provide notification to STA management for issues that require Site STA team awareness / intervention.
  • Act as direct Plant Vehicle Team (PVT) resident supplier representative and liaison between STA and plant management, support Daily Plant Quality Meetings (or PIC Room) to report on containment of SP ECB (Early Concern Binning) issues, participate in VRT forums, lead supplier preparation for VQRs (Vehicle Quality Review).
